Transaction 034f8a41716bbae79266d0554368d31b5d210b63c33f7af52aa6daa3451066fa

3 Input
2 Outputs
  • 034f8a41716bbae79266d0554368d31b5d210b63c33f7af52aa6daa3451066fa:0
  • value  94147
    address  1EKcabjcgvXmGFM577Vwo4Z3KK1TCVhhd9
  • 034f8a41716bbae79266d0554368d31b5d210b63c33f7af52aa6daa3451066fa:1
  • value  2074000
    address  3NJ52guQVTjSEo4XKPMkLb7bxfjAXsiCvb